NOTES: A. Output skew, t
sk(o),
is calculated as the greater of:
– The difference between the fastest and slowest of t
PLHn
(n = 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10)
– The difference between the fastest and slowest of t
PHLn
(n = 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10)
B. Pulse skew, t
sk(p)
, is calculated as the greater of | t
PLH
n – t
PHLn
| (n = 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10).
C. Process skew, t
sk(pr)
, is calculated as the greater of:
– The difference between the fastest and slowest of t
PLHn
(n = 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10) across multiple devices under identical operating conditions
– The difference between the fastest and slowest of t
PHLn
(n = 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10) across multiple devices under identical operating conditions
